Job Description
Job Title: NQ – 5 Years PQE Private Client Solicitor
Salary: Dependent on experience
Location: Chester
Purpose of the Role
- To manage the full range of private client matters, including Wills, Powers of Attorney, Estate Administrations, and Trusts, while delivering a profitable contribution to the team.
- To support the ongoing development of the practice in line with strategic business objectives.
Key Responsibilities
- Conduct client matters with accuracy, professionalism, and in line with regulatory and quality standards (Lexcel and SRA Code of Conduct).
- Generate fee income and manage time recording, work in progress, billing, and cash collection in accordance with agreed targets.
- Actively participate in business development initiatives to grow the client base and strengthen the team’s profile.
- Provide supervision and support to colleagues, including covering fee-earning work during absences or holidays.
- Supervise other fee earners where required.
- Take part in marketing and networking activities at team, office, or wider professional levels.
- Deliver excellent client care by meeting clients in person and over the telephone, providing clear, supportive, and professional advice.
- Draft and manage correspondence and documents through the case management system.
- Ensure efficient organisation of both electronic and paper files, including opening, closing, storing, and retrieving client files in accordance with office procedures.
- Attend and contribute to team meetings.
- Develop new work opportunities from existing and prospective clients, while maintaining and nurturing a strong network of professional contacts and referrers.
- Maintain strong IT and communication skills, with the ability to use case management systems, email, internet research tools, and telephony systems effectively.
Skills and Attributes
- Alignment with professional core values and commitment to upholding them.
- Strong communication skills, both written and verbal, with clients, colleagues, and external contacts.
- Highly organised, efficient, and capable of managing tasks conscientiously within required timescales.
- Positive, collaborative team player with a proactive attitude.
- Detail-oriented, accurate, and reliable in all aspects of work.
- Self-motivated, professional, and able to work independently using initiative.
Experience and Education
- Qualified solicitor, legal executive, or equivalent (NQ up to 5 years’ PQE).
- Relevant experience in private client matters, including Wills, Powers of Attorney, Estate Administration, and Trusts.
